Description

Dive into unparalleled bass precision with the Subwoofer Pros Studio Sub2-12C, an exquisitely crafted studio subwoofer that seamlessly integrates with any nearfield monitors. With its 700-watt power and 12-inch high-excursion driver, this subwoofer delivers a profound low-frequency response, reaching as low as 16Hz. Whether you're laying down tracks for a thumping bass line or mixing a delicate acoustic set, the Studio Sub2-12C ensures every note is felt as much as it's heard.

Engineered for versatility, the Studio Sub2-12C features an onboard selectable lowpass filter with options at 95Hz, 80Hz, 60Hz, and 40Hz, allowing for effortless integration into any professional monitoring setup. Its simple yet effective control panel minimizes setup errors, ensuring that your audio environment is always optimal. Housed in an 18mm, 13-ply birch plywood sealed cabinet, the subwoofer not only provides robust sound but is also built to withstand the rigors of studio life.

Designed to maintain a uniform response at every frequency and listening level, this subwoofer's dynamic electronics guarantee that each bass note is as tight and clear as the last, regardless of the volume. Key Features:

  • 700-watt active 12-inch studio subwoofer
  • 18mm, 13-ply birch plywood sealed cabinet
  • 12-inch high-excursion EL-12B driver
  • Input connectors: 2 x XLR, line-level summing
  • Lowpass filter: 95Hz, 80Hz, 60Hz, 40Hz selectable
  • Polarity switch; dynamic filter overload protection
  • Frequency response: ±3dB, 16Hz to 95, 80, 60, or 40Hz (contingent on switch position)
  • Max SPL: 100dB SPL @ 1 meter
  • Mains voltage: 100–240 VAC, auto sensing

How does the sealed enclosure design of the Subwoofer Pros Studio Sub2-12C affect its performance?

The sealed enclosure design of the Subwoofer Pros Studio Sub2-12C provides tighter bass response and more accurate sound reproduction, making it suitable for critical listening environments where precision is key.
